Two Trees CNC Vacuum Cleaner Monster — Hands-On Review

We were really excited to order and set up the Two Trees CNC Vacuum Cleaner Monster. The ergonomic design and compact form factor were what sold us on making the purchase, so we decided to give it a try.

Construction

The unit is made from powder-coated sheet metal with generally good tolerances and a solid, professional appearance.

Controls

Simple and functional — an ON/OFF switch and a vacuum motor speed control ranging from low to high.

Accessories

The package includes two fixed and two articulating wheels, vacuum hose connectors (3D-printed), a vacuum hose with clamps, and a sleek hose attachment for the CNC router motor.
However, the included hose attachment only fits the small motor shipped with the TTC450 Pro and will not fit larger 30k RPM wood routers.

On the plus side, the machine features a large, well-fitted slide-out air filter and a generously sized dust bin — both nicely executed.

Shortcomings

Unfortunately, several details were disappointing:

The Allen head screws supplied for wheel attachment stripped easily (poor-quality alloy).

The wheel mounting holes required re-tapping because the threads were clogged with powder coat.

The hose attachments were 3D-printed in PLA, which felt like a corner cut on a product at this price point.

All of these could have been forgiven if the vacuum performance were up to par — but that’s where this product falls short.

Performance

The motor and fan assembly simply do not produce meaningful suction. There are no published airflow specifications (CFM), which should have been an early warning.
For reference, a small shop vac typically pulls 85–100 CFM, and larger ones exceed 150 CFM. This unit delivers nowhere near that level.

When I contacted Two Trees support, I was advised to “check for a bent hose,” which didn’t inspire confidence.

Final Thoughts

At $439 delivered, the ergonomics and aesthetics are nice, but the lack of suction performance makes it a poor investment.
You can find far better options for the same price — they may not look as sleek, but they’ll actually perform the job.
